Position Summary A distinguished executive and their family are seeking an exceptional, discreet, and highly organized Executive Housekeeper to maintain their primary residence to the highest standards. This role requires an individual who takes pride in creating an immaculate, welcoming, and well-managed home environment while exercising sound judgment, professionalism, and respect for the privacy and unique needs of a high-profile household.
The Executive Housekeeper is responsible for the daily upkeep, deep cleaning, organization, laundry, and household presentation of the residence. This position also supports preparation of the home for high-level University events and gatherings, ensuring the residence is consistently guest-ready and presented at the highest standard for hosting, hospitality, and institutional engagement.
Job Description
Primary Duties & Responsibilities:
• Maintains all areas of the residence in pristine condition, including daily upkeep, deep cleaning, organization, and overall household presentation. Manages laundry and wardrobe care for the family, including care of delicate fabrics and coordination of dry cleaning as needed. Maintains household supplies and inventories, including cleaning products, linens, guest supplies, and other household essentials; monitors stock levels and communicates replenishment needs in a timely manner. • Prepares the main floor and other designated areas of the residence for personal and professional events, ensuring spaces are immaculate, properly configured, and guest-ready. Assists with event setup and breakdown, including furniture arrangement, table settings, and other household preparations. • Assists with logistics for home repairs and maintenance projects in coordination with the Executive Services Coordinator. Provides access to vendors and contractors, documents and relays maintenance issues, and serves as an on-site point of contact to help ensure timely resolution and minimal disruption to household routines. • Anticipates household needs and proactively addresses matters related to cleanliness, organization, supplies, and overall household readiness before they become issues. • Perform other duties as assigned
